executive summary

The San Antonio Tex-Mex market is demonstrably robust and highly competitive, characterized by deeply entrenched establishments boasting high ratings and significant review volumes. Competitors such as Mi Tierra, La Fonda On Main, La Fogata, Los Azulejos, and Maria Bonita consistently achieve ratings between 4.2 and 4.8, with review counts ranging from 2,806 to an astounding 24,537. This indicates a strong, consistent demand for Tex-Mex cuisine within the city. These existing players are generally priced at a moderate level ('2'), suggesting accessibility to a broad consumer base. Their success is largely attributed to vibrant atmospheres, consistent service quality, and a focus on traditional, often indulgent, Tex-Mex flavors.

However, a critical market gap exists: the explicit offering of 'Authentic 'Healthy' Tex-Mex.' While traditional Tex-Mex is beloved, it is often perceived as calorie-dense, high in fat and sodium. San Antonio's demographic profile, characterized by a large Hispanic population with a strong cultural affinity for Tex-Mex, is also evolving. There is a growing segment of health-conscious consumers, including younger demographics and those prioritizing wellness, who seek healthier dining options without sacrificing flavor or authenticity. This segment is currently underserved within the Tex-Mex category.

The proposed concept directly addresses this void. 'Authentic 'Healthy' Tex-Mex' implies a commitment to traditional flavor profiles and cooking techniques, but with a strategic pivot towards fresh, high-quality, often locally sourced ingredients, lean proteins, whole grains, and reduced fat/sodium preparations. This differentiation is not merely about offering 'lighter' versions but about re-engineering classic dishes to be nutritionally superior while retaining their core Tex-Mex identity. Transparency in nutritional information, clear labeling for dietary restrictions (e.g., gluten-free, plant-based, low-carb), and a modern, health-aligned ambiance will be crucial.

Challenges include overcoming ingrained perceptions of Tex-Mex as inherently indulgent and educating consumers on how 'healthy' can still be 'authentic' and delicious. However, the market potential is significant. By strategically positioning itself as the premier destination for guilt-free, authentic Tex-Mex, the concept can capture a substantial share of both the existing health-conscious market and those traditional Tex-Mex diners seeking healthier alternatives without abandoning their culinary heritage. The high logic score reflects the strong demand for Tex-Mex combined with the clear, unaddressed niche for health-focused options, minimizing direct competition with established, traditional players.

review sentiment audit

top praises
  • Vibrant, colorful, and unique restaurant atmosphere and decor, often described as 'iconic' or 'gorgeous'.

  • Exceptional and attentive service, characterized as 'fast, friendly, helpful,' 'impeccable,' and 'outstanding'.

  • High quality and delicious food, with descriptions like 'tasty,' 'fresh,' 'well-prepared,' and 'best Mexican food ever'.

  • Variety and quality of drinks, including unique margaritas and agua frescas.

  • Strong sense of tradition, history, and being a long-standing, beloved local institution.

top complaints
  • Inconsistent portion sizes and perceived value for money, with some customers feeling portions were too small for the price.

  • Occasional inconsistencies in food quality, such as dry meats or average-tasting fillings.

  • Long waiting times, especially during peak hours, due to high popularity.

  • Challenges with parking availability and convenience, particularly at busy locations.

  • Specific minor issues with side dishes, such as rice or beans, not meeting expectations.
